Transaction 539059e36da052df1b6bfc484a175b729a231da2c7ae3578aa65a715a3afdd86

2 Input
2 Outputs
  • 539059e36da052df1b6bfc484a175b729a231da2c7ae3578aa65a715a3afdd86:0
  • value  104488
    address  16giu5TVoDPmxsTNxXc1oUqL8TiLcMpkYz
  • 539059e36da052df1b6bfc484a175b729a231da2c7ae3578aa65a715a3afdd86:1
  • value  838500
    address  18gNQAtcpnuJXXgaWYyzXgSFpVXxTgNZBj